Patient: K7203
Symptoms:
1. High b+ 139 and not 121. Couldn't adjust down far enough.

2.Squealing / High pitch sound

Solution: replaced cap c009 22uf. Caps on these usually fix a lot of issues but just replacing c009 fixes the noise and the b+. I was able to adjust b+ enough once I replaced c009 So a bad c009 caused high b+ which caused the noise.

several caps were bad, however C009 was the very first one I tried

I had one with an obnoxious squeal, it wound up being one of the plugs to the neckboard needed to be resoldered. (the stationary one on the deflection board side)
